A new NZ Paragliding triangle record at 197km.


The 23rd December 2019 turned out to be an epic day for flying in Otago. Lots of pilots set out for cross-country flights but one, in particular, was of note.
Louis Tapper got airborne from Treble Cone about 1130am and flew a triangular route first south to Cardrona, west to the head of the Routeburn then northeast to Makarora and back to Treble Cone. The flight lasted over the 8 hours and resulted in the smashing of the NZ paragliding triangle record by flying 197km.



Louis had been planning such a flight for some time with a view to beating 200km and so was well prepared. The final turnpoint for that 200km proved elusive as the day began to slow and he'd been caught out with a long walk-out some months before.
